Skill: Refua

Summary

Refua is used in drug discovery to computationally fold and score biomolecular complexes (e.g., protein–ligand/protein–protein) and optionally profile ADMET, helping prioritize which molecules to synthesize and test first in a drug discovery pipeline.

This skill runs and connects to the refua-mcp MCP server, which exposes Refua’s “unified Complex API” as MCP tools for:

  • Boltz2 complex folding (+ optional affinity evaluation)
  • BoltzGen design workflows
  • Optional ADMET profiling (when installed)

Clawdbot supports MCP natively, so the only requirement is running this MCP server and calling its tools. (github.com)


When to use

Use this skill when you need to:

  • Fold a protein–ligand, protein–protein, or (fold-only) DNA/RNA complex
  • Estimate binding affinity for a specified binder within a complex spec
  • Run ADMET predictions for one or more SMILES ligands (if enabled)
  • Execute GPU/CPU-heavy Refua workflows via MCP tool calls

Do NOT use this skill when:

  • The task is a simple deterministic calculation (prefer a non-ML tool)
  • The user expects you to invent sequences/SMILES (request inputs instead)
  • The user requests unsafe wet-lab or clinical guidance

Installation & assets (operator steps)

1) Install Refua + refua-mcp

Install Refua (CPU or CUDA), then install the MCP server package: (github.com)

  • GPU support:
    • pip install refua[cuda]
  • CPU-only:
    • pip install refua
  • MCP server:
    • pip install refua-mcp

2) Optional: enable ADMET

ADMET tool support is optional and requires an extra: (github.com)

  • pip install refua[admet]

3) Download model/assets

Boltz2 and BoltzGen require model/molecule assets. Refua can download them automatically: (github.com)

  • python -c "from refua import download_assets; download_assets()"

Default asset locations + overrides: (github.com)

  • Boltz2 uses ~/.boltz by default
    • Override via tool option boltz.cache_dir if needed
  • BoltzGen uses a bundled HF artifact by default
    • Override via tool option boltzgen.mol_dir if needed

Running the MCP server

Start the server using the module entrypoint: (github.com)

python3 -m refua_mcp.server
